Output 32ed8ee996d299f4ff17be42909ba8624467f44e5ccb37e1467e4e4dbc18fbe6:1

value
13394216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0361c123d2fec4f4cb64dd38806181e20835be06 OP_EQUAL
address
M8D3N6zaT9YEstTHLC5oDFerukX2mgFaUF
transaction
32ed8ee996d299f4ff17be42909ba8624467f44e5ccb37e1467e4e4dbc18fbe6
spent
true